Wolviston Management Services is seeking a Part-Time Finance Assistant in Ferryhill, UK. This role requires flexible work hours (3 days/week) and experience in finance, specifically with Xero. You will support the finance team with accounts, payroll, and pensions, while contributing to a collaborative atmosphere.

Ideal candidates will have:

  • A strong attention to detail
  • Organizational skills
  • A proven finance background

This is an excellent opportunity within a growing company, offering a competitive salary pro-rata based on experience.

How to prepare for a job interview at Wolviston Management Services

Know Your Xero Inside Out

Make sure you brush up on your Xero skills before the interview. Familiarise yourself with its features, especially those related to payroll and accounts. Being able to discuss specific functionalities or share past experiences using Xero will show that you're ready to hit the ground running.

Show Off Your Attention to Detail

In finance, attention to detail is crucial. Prepare examples from your previous roles where your meticulous nature made a difference. Whether it was catching an error in a report or ensuring payroll accuracy, these stories will highlight your strengths and fit for the role.

Be Ready to Discuss Flexibility

Since this position requires flexible working hours, be prepared to discuss your availability and how you can adapt to the team's needs. Showing that you understand the importance of flexibility in a collaborative environment will make you stand out as a candidate.

Prepare Questions About the Team

Demonstrate your interest in the company culture by preparing thoughtful questions about the finance team and their collaborative approach. Asking about how they support each other or handle challenges together can show that you’re not just looking for a job, but a place where you can contribute positively.
